The Appledore-Instow Ferry: A Journey Through Time

The Appledore-Instow Ferry is a charming and historic service that has been connecting the two North Devon villages of Appledore and Instow for centuries. Operated by dedicated volunteers, the ferry provides a vital link across the estuary, offering both locals and visitors a unique and enjoyable way to travel between these two picturesque locations.
